Mochi
Rice cake
Everyone,
What recipe of mochi shall we choose?
e.g. Kinako-Mochi (Rice cake with <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Kinako">soybean flour</a>), Isobe-Mochi (Roasted rice cake with soy sauce and <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Nori">edible seaweed</a>), Su-Mochi (Rice cake with <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Ponzu">ponzu</a> and grated radish), Zunda-Mochi (Rice cake with soybeans paste), Age-Mochi (Fried rice cake) and Ankoro-Mochi (Rice cake wrapped in <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Sweet_bean_paste">sweet bean paste</a>).
Chikara-Mochi!
Means "mighty person."
Kane-Mochi!
Means "rich person."
Then,
Mochi-Mochi♥
Means "soft and a bit viscous textures" or "soft and fine skin."
I'll choose Karami-Mochi.
Rice cake with grated radish.
